Safeguarding:
At Places for People, safeguarding is everyone’s responsibility. We are committed to creating safe communities for our customers and colleagues by protecting children, young people, and adults at risk from harm, abuse, and neglect. We follow robust safeguarding policies and procedures, ensuring all employees, volunteers, and contractors uphold the highest standards of safeguarding and accountability. Our recruitment process includes pre-employment checks, including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) checks where applicable, to promote a safe and secure working environment. By joining Places for People, you are expected to contribute to our safeguarding culture, following our policies and reporting concerns to protect those in our communities.

How to prepare for a job interview at Touchstone
✨Know Your People Promises
Before the interview, take some time to familiarise yourself with Places for People's People Promises. They’re all about doing the right thing and embodying community spirit. Show how your values align with theirs during the interview to demonstrate that you’re not just a candidate, but a perfect fit for their culture.
✨Showcase Your Customer Service Skills
Since this role is all about customer interaction, prepare specific examples from your past experiences where you’ve excelled in customer service. Think of situations where you resolved complaints or went above and beyond for a customer. This will highlight your ability to provide top-notch service, which is crucial for the role.
✨Communicate Clearly and Confidently
Good communication skills are essential for this position. Practice articulating your thoughts clearly and confidently. You might even want to do a mock interview with a friend or family member to get comfortable with speaking about your experiences and answering questions succinctly.
✨Prepare Questions About the Role
At the end of the interview, you’ll likely have the chance to ask questions. Prepare thoughtful questions about the team dynamics, training opportunities, or what success looks like in this role.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
